Google to buy marketing services unit of ICG

Google is buying internet firm Channel Intelligence, marketing services unit of ICG Group Inc., for $125 million. The internet giant’s latest acquisition, which completes in the first quarter of 2013, is aimed at expanding its retail footprint, reports The Economic Times. Fidelity launches U.S. All Cap Fund

Fidelity Investments Canada ULC today launched Fidelity U.S. All Cap Fund, a new mutual fund for Canadian investors seeking U.S. investment exposure. WEF: liquidity bubble a risk as economy improves

Attention was drawn, on the fourth day of the 43rd World Economic Forum (WEF) in Davos, Switzerland, to the risk of a liquidity bubble as the global economy gains momentum.
